What Smart Devices Bring to Business Operations
Smart devices integrate seamlessly into core operations, enabling real-time data capture, streamlined workflows, and improved decision-making. By leveraging sensor analytics and edge automation, organizations gain autonomous monitoring, rapid anomaly detection, and proactive maintenance.
This approach reduces downtime, enhances operational visibility, and supports scalable processes. The result is greater agility, controlled risk, and freedom to pursue strategic opportunities with confidence and accountability.
